Explain how the lives of minorities differed from those of white middle-class Americans during the 1950s?

Answer:

In the 1950s, many minorities were significantly poorer than middle class whites. Since this was before the civil rights movement of the 1960s, discrimination was also still commonplace for minorities. In general, the lives of these people were worse than the lives of white middle class Americans.
